FYR of Macedonia Clinic 2012
110 referees and commissioners attended the Ohrid clinic that was supported by FIBA Europe

Ahead of the upcoming club season, the Basketball Federation of F.Y.R. of Macedonia organised its annual national referee clinic in Ohrid, a city that has seen a lot of international basketball in recent years.

The clinic received full support by FIBA Europe, as FIBA Europe instructor William Jones, together with FIBA Commissioners Gjorgi Piperkov and Dejan Lekic, the Secretary General of the Basketball Federation of F.Y.R. of Macedonia, were the lecturers during the three days of classes.

110 referees and commissioners from all over the country took part in the event that was held from 21 to 23 September.

The lectures included all aspects of modern refereeing, such as "Communication and Game Management", "Pre-game Conference and Criteria of Calling Fouls" as well as a rules update for 2012.

The latest FIBA Europe teaching materials were also distributed to all participants free of charge and an extra session was dedicated to those materials, including a discussion of various clips.

The programme concluded with a workshop on referee mistakes and the national youth competition system in F.Y.R. of Macedonia for the 2012/13 season.

All attending referees underwent physical tests and also sat an obligatory theoretical exam on their knowledge of basketball rules, a test that attending commissioners also had to take.
